Key Features of the Canon EOS R6 Mark II

24.2 megapixel full-frame sensor for high-resolution images
ISO range of 100-102400 for versatile shooting in low light
Continuous shooting speeds up to 40 fps for action shots
Intelligent subject detection using deep learning technology

Key Features of the Sony Alpha a7 III

24.2MP full-frame sensor for superior image quality
Wide ISO range from 50 to 204,800 for low-light performance
10fps continuous shooting with both silent and mechanical shutter options
Comprehensive lens compatibility with the E-mount system

How to Choose Best compact mirrorless camera with interchangeable lens

Choosing the right compact mirrorless camera with interchangeable lenses involves several factors. Below are key aspects to consider when making your selection.

Sensor Size

The size of the sensor impacts image quality significantly. Larger sensors typically offer better performance in low-light conditions and greater depth of field control.

  • Full-frame sensors for professional quality
  • APS-C sensors for a balance of size and performance
  • Micro Four Thirds for more compact systems

Video Capabilities

If you plan to shoot videos, look for a camera with 4K video recording and features like slow-motion and high frame rates. This will enhance your content creation experience.

  • 4K recording for high-quality video
  • Slow-motion options for creative effects
  • Built-in stabilization features

Autofocus System

An advanced autofocus system is crucial, especially for action shots or moving subjects. Look for features like Dual Pixel autofocus or face detection.

  • Fast and accurate focus tracking
  • Eye detection for portraits
  • Multiple focus points for flexibility

Weight and Portability

Since you’ll likely be carrying your camera around, consider its weight and size. A lightweight design is ideal for travel and street photography.

  • Compact size for easy handling
  • Lightweight materials for portability
  • Ergonomic design for comfortable shooting

User Interface

A user-friendly interface can greatly enhance your shooting experience. Look for cameras with intuitive menus and touchscreen capabilities.

  • Touchscreen for easy navigation
  • Customizable controls
  • Clear display for shooting info

Myth vs Fact

There are many misconceptions about compact mirrorless cameras. Here are some myths and facts to clarify common misunderstandings.

Myth: Mirrorless cameras are not as durable as DSLRs.
Fact: Many mirrorless models are built with durable materials and can withstand tough conditions.

Modern mirrorless cameras often feature weather-sealed bodies.

Myth: All mirrorless cameras are expensive.
Fact: There are budget-friendly options available that deliver excellent image quality.

The market offers a variety of models at different price points.

Myth: Mirrorless cameras have poor battery life.
Fact: While some models may have shorter battery life, many have improved significantly over time.

Advancements in battery technology have helped enhance performance.

Myth: You need expensive lenses to get good results.
Fact: Quality lenses are available at various price points; it's about choosing the right lens for your needs.

Many budget lenses perform well for everyday photography.
